Selection Criteria for Recruit Company Commanders: Development and Evaluation.

Abstract

An effort to develop procedures for use in selection of prospective recruit company commanders was undertaken in support of CNTT requirements. An experimental battery of paper-and-pencil tests was developed and evaluated against a variety of measures of company commander effectiveness. Results indicated that an interest inventory was the most valid predictor of effectiveness. Recommendations concerning its use were made.
